C# Класс BuildIt.Lifecycle.BaseApplication

Показать файл Открыть проект

Открытые методы

Метод Описание
RegisterAdditionalDependencies ( Action build ) : void
Startup ( ServiceLocatorProvider locatorProvider, IDependencyContainer container, Action buildDependencies = null ) : System.Threading.Tasks.Task

Защищенные методы

Метод Описание
BuildCoreDependencies ( IDependencyContainer container ) : System.Threading.Tasks.Task
CommenceStartup ( ) : System.Threading.Tasks.Task
CompleteStartup ( ) : System.Threading.Tasks.Task
RegisterDependencies ( IDependencyContainer builder ) : void

Описание методов

BuildCoreDependencies() защищенный Метод

protected BuildCoreDependencies ( IDependencyContainer container ) : System.Threading.Tasks.Task
container IDependencyContainer
Результат System.Threading.Tasks.Task

CommenceStartup() защищенный Метод

protected CommenceStartup ( ) : System.Threading.Tasks.Task
Результат System.Threading.Tasks.Task

CompleteStartup() защищенный Метод

protected CompleteStartup ( ) : System.Threading.Tasks.Task
Результат System.Threading.Tasks.Task

RegisterAdditionalDependencies() публичный Метод

public RegisterAdditionalDependencies ( Action build ) : void
build Action
Результат void

RegisterDependencies() защищенный Метод

protected RegisterDependencies ( IDependencyContainer builder ) : void
builder IDependencyContainer
Результат void

Startup() публичный Метод

public Startup ( ServiceLocatorProvider locatorProvider, IDependencyContainer container, Action buildDependencies = null ) : System.Threading.Tasks.Task
locatorProvider ServiceLocatorProvider
container IDependencyContainer
buildDependencies Action
Результат System.Threading.Tasks.Task